-
Brett Wilson authored
This reverts commit 55364a64. Reason for revert: Broke component build https://build.chromium.org/p/chromium.gpu.fyi/builders/GPU%20Win%20Clang%20Builder%20%28dbg%29/builds/16604 While that's just an FYI bot, this also broke my local x86 Windows debug builds. Original change's description: > Add UKM Document.OutliveTimeAfterShutdown > > This CL adds a new UKM Document.OutliveTimeAfterShutdown, that is > recorded when a Document object survives 5, 10, 20 or 50 garbage > collections after detached. If a document outlives such long time, the > document might be leaked. The UKM would be very useful to know where such > leaky documents exist and to fix them. > > Design doc: https://docs.google.com/document/d/1fbs5smdd-pBLLMpq7u8EkyddZILtI7CZPJlo_AA1kak/edit?usp=sharing > > Bug: 757374 > Change-Id: Idc05b03f625db11ab54c5203d18344b1ca72b4eb > Reviewed-on: https://chromium-review.googlesource.com/647050 > Commit-Queue: Hajime Hoshi <hajimehoshi@chromium.org> > Reviewed-by: Kent Tamura <tkent@chromium.org> > Reviewed-by: Chris Palmer <palmer@chromium.org> > Reviewed-by: Steven Holte <holte@chromium.org> > Reviewed-by: Brett Wilson <brettw@chromium.org> > Reviewed-by: Kentaro Hara <haraken@chromium.org> > Reviewed-by: Nico Weber <thakis@chromium.org> > Cr-Commit-Position: refs/heads/master@{#505275} TBR=palmer@chromium.org,thakis@chromium.org,brettw@chromium.org,erikchen@chromium.org,hajimehoshi@chromium.org,haraken@chromium.org,tkent@chromium.org,holte@chromium.org Change-Id: Ie3e3e3ec3ce401d934cd5af4453e0ca92a1d8a63 No-Presubmit: true No-Tree-Checks: true No-Try: true Bug: 757374 Reviewed-on: https://chromium-review.googlesource.com/692840 Reviewed-by: Brett Wilson <brettw@chromium.org> Commit-Queue: Brett Wilson <brettw@chromium.org> Cr-Commit-Position: refs/heads/master@{#505448}
028cc769